Abstract
IT may, perhaps, be worth while to notice a few consequences of three theories concerning color which are usually regarded with some favor.First hypothesis.-Theappearance of every mixture of lights depends solely on the appearances of the constituents, without distinction of their physical constitution.This I believe is established.&cond hypothesi-s.-Everysensation of light is compounded of not more than three independent sensations, which do not influence one an0ther.This is Young's theory.It follows that, if we denote the units of the three elementary sensations by i, j, amI k, every sensation of light may be represented by an expression of the form, Xi+Yj+Zk.Third hypothesis.-Theintensity of a sellsation is proportional• to the logarithm of the strength of the excitation, the barely perceptible excitation being taken of unit strength.Negative logarithms al'e to be taken as zero.'l'his is Fechner's law.It is known to be approximately and only approximately true, for the sensation of light.From this it follows that, if x, y, z be the relative proportions of a mixture of three lights giving the elementary sensations i, j, k, the sensation produced by the mixture is I loga:.i+Jlogy.j+Klogz.k,where I, J, K, are three constants.From these principles, it follows that if a light giving any sensation such as that just written have its intensity increased in any ratio r, the resulting sensation will be,
